> I experienced this same problem during a recent migration to RAIDframe
> Auto-configuration.  I had a RAID 1 root auto-configured RAID set, and a
> RAID 0 auto-configured set.  The source tree I was using dates back to
> August 5th so it is obviously outside of your 12-hour window.  However,
> I pinpointed my hang due to a CD-ROM being connected to the IDE port on
> the motherboard.  Without the CD-ROM drive, the RAIDframe Auto-configure
> would proceed as expected.
